Property Eligibility
Is My El Cajon, CA Property Eligible for an ADU?
El Cajon homeowners benefit from California's state ADU law — one of the most permissive frameworks in the country since 2020. Here's what applies to your property before you start designing.
Single-Family Home
Permitted on single-family lots in El Cajon under California state law. No owner-occupancy requirement in El Cajon — you can rent both units as investment properties. Ministerial permit approval — no neighbor input or discretionary design review.
Multi-Family Property
Up to 2 detached ADUs plus JADUs (Junior ADUs) within the existing main structure are permitted under California state law. Especially valuable for duplexes and apartment buildings looking to add density.
HOA-Governed Properties
Approximately 20% of El Cajon homes are in an HOA. California law (AB 670) prohibits HOAs from banning ADUs outright, but they can impose reasonable architectural standards. Our drawings include HOA submission formatting.

Local Zoning Rules
El Cajon ADU Zoning Regulations
| Regulation | El Cajon Allowance |
|---|---|
| Max ADU Size | 1,200 sq ft |
| Max Height | 20 ft |
| Side Setback | 4 ft |
| Rear Setback | 4 ft |
| Owner Occupancy | Not required |
| Short-Term Rental | Restricted |
| Coastal Overlay | No |
| Design Review | Yes - in historic districts only |
| HOA Prevalence | 20% of properties |
Data verified recently. Always confirm with the Building Safety Division before designing.

Building Code
El Cajon Climate Zone & Energy Code
Under California Title 24 (2022 Energy Code), newly constructed detached ADUs must meet mandatory envelope, ventilation, and lighting measures, satisfy prescriptive solar PV requirements unless an exception applies, and comply with electric-ready and energy storage system (ESS) ready provisions.
